![]() Charles Berner, the originator of the Enlightenment Intensive explains his definition of enlightenment published in Enlightenment and the Enlightenment Intensive; Volume 1. http://www.amazon.com/dp/1492267546 “Enlightenment literally means to put light onto so one can be conscious of what one has set out to experience. Enlightenment is the direct experience of the truth. In the case of self enlightenment, it is the direct experience of the truths of you. By direct experience is meant, by no way or via. Not by seeing, thinking, believing, deciding, reasoning, feeling, or any way ‘by way of’. Direct experience of the truth is Enlightenment. The first important, well documented enlightenment was that of Buddha.” ![]() Here’s a review of the book by an Amazon Customer. “This small but well written book tells you everything you need to know about the enlightenment intensive process.
